Trump: U.S. Would Withdraw From United Nations Arms Trade Treaty

Unic Press UK: The United States would withdraw from the United Nations Arms Trade Treaty, President Donald Trump said Friday during the National Rifle Association (NRA) annual convention.

“Under my administration, we will never surrender American sovereignty to anyone. We will never allow foreign diplomats to trample on your Second Amendment freedom. The United Nations will soon receive a formal notice that America is rejecting this treaty.”

The Treaty, which was approved in April 2013 by the United Nations General Assembly to regulate global trading in conventional arms, does not meet well with the NRA and several other gun activists.

Reacting to the Trump administration decision, Kris Brown, who heads Brady – an organisation advocating an end to gun violence –  wrote on Twitter:

“By denouncing the Global Arms Treaty, @realDonaldTrump will only embolden terrorists and other dangerous actors around the world. This is a reckless move that will endanger countless Americans and other innocent people worldwide. #NRAAM #EndGunViolence.”
